A Literary Treasure
First published in 1906 by Andrew Lang, The Orange Fairy Book is part of a beloved series of fairy tale collections that have become synonymous with the genre. Lang, a renowned folklorist and literary scholar, spent decades meticulously gathering these stories from various sources, including ancient folklore, oral traditions, and literary adaptations. The result is a rich tapestry of tales that span cultures and centuries, offering a glimpse into the timeless power of storytelling.
